I have read the debates re: 5k vs 5.5k vs 7k and noted previous (neg) comments about 5.5’s sound. That said, there does seem to be no question about the 5.5HC center being highly prized as a center speaker. It IS massive and would certainly be up to any cinematic theatrics thrown at it, I would think. But never having heard it, why is IT so highly rated (while not so much as a vertical L/R)?

I suspect that may have been down to the fact that there were no realistic alternatives if you had large DSPs. There was a centre 6000, or a single 8000 but they pretty much required a very high screen height, or an acoustically transparent screen. A single 7000 offered a bit more screen flexibility, but until the 7200HC it was the only large HC DSP. Having previously tried a 5000HC with 6000 mains, I found it was too much of a compromise on both movies and music.
